DIGITAL ENCODE DEPLOYS AI TO COMBAT CYBER THREATS
Digital Encode, a Nigerian cybersecurity company, has launched DEPAS AI, an autonomous artificial intelligence platform designed to help organisations identify and test weaknesses in their digital systems.
The new platform is aimed at helping Nigerian businesses respond to increasingly sophisticated cyber threats by providing automated security assessments and identifying vulnerabilities that could be exploited by attackers.
DEPAS AI uses artificial intelligence to examine an organisation’s digital environment, detect potential security weaknesses and conduct controlled tests to determine how vulnerable systems may be to cyberattacks.
According to Digital Encode, the technology is designed to make cybersecurity assessments faster and more efficient while helping organisations strengthen their defences.
The company said the platform can support businesses that may not have the resources or personnel to conduct frequent and comprehensive cybersecurity testing manually.
The launch comes as Nigerian businesses continue to face growing cybersecurity risks, including data breaches, ransomware, phishing attacks and other forms of digital fraud.
Digital Encode said organisations need to move beyond reacting to cyber incidents and instead adopt proactive measures that identify vulnerabilities before criminals can exploit them.
The company also highlighted the importance of artificial intelligence in the future of cybersecurity, noting that cyber threats are evolving rapidly and require equally advanced defensive technologies.
DEPAS AI is expected to provide organisations with greater visibility into their security posture and help them prioritise vulnerabilities that require immediate attention.
Digital Encode said its goal is to help Nigerian companies improve their cybersecurity resilience while supporting the country’s broader digital transformation.
